MANTA BOARD: FEBRUARY 2026


The MANTA Board is posted every month, but the quests are on a "2 month cycle." This means quests can last for two months with possible updates or new additions in the second month before it completely refreshes for the next cycle. Players can do older quests so long as they did not have some kind of resolution or time limit on them.

For this month's board update, some quests have been updated to reflect progress from last month, with some carrying over as is.

Quests are separated into five categories and all have flat point values: General (4pts), Corsair (4pts), Paladin (4pts), Bounties (6pts), and Specials (12pts). Crew quests are listed under "Specials" and are worth the same amount of points (12pts). Although these quests are intended for established crews, non-members are allowed to assist if the crew invites them. However, non-members would only receive 6pts. Similarly, characters helping opposing armada quests will only be rewarded 2pts for participation unless specified otherwise. Special quests won't always be available so it may appear blank at times. These can range from group quests such as for special ship upgrades or island related quests, or they could be special event quests. All quest points can be used for the Rewards Shop.

If you wish to submit a quest, comment in the appropriate field during Activity Check with the quest written and we'll add it to the next month! Crews are also still allowed to make their own quests without our approval, but if uncertain players can comment here about them.

If you have any questions regarding any current quest, comment to this entry.
